PP&L-CLEARWATER VILLAGE is one of 1,168 community water systems in Oregon in the 500 or fewer people size category, serving 60 people from groundwater.

As of August 1, 2026, its federal record holds 21 entries between 1993 and 2013, all of which EPA lists as closed. Nothing has been added since 2013.

All 21 are monitoring and reporting requirements — the category that accounts for about four in five of all violations in EPA's national dataset — rather than findings about the water itself. The record involves inorganic chemicals, volatile organic chemicals, and synthetic organic chemicals.

What is a Consumer Confidence Report?

A Consumer Confidence Report (CCR) is the annual drinking water quality report that community water systems must provide to the people they serve. It lists the contaminants detected in the system’s water during the year, where the water comes from, and how the results compare with federal limits. EPA’s revised CCR rule takes effect January 1, 2027, and the first reports in the new format are due July 1, 2027.
